running on 2 stroke engine. ninja 250 is 4 stroke.
2 stroke maintenance slight higher than 4 stroke. 2 stroke uses 2T oil once every two week for the krr.

no. is cheaper running than car. fulltank for krr can around rm12-15 ringgit can run 300km.

the price probably around 4k-6k depending on years,...some newer years can 7k-8k

-you can check the market price for a second hand krr

-depends on bike condition , i got mine less than a year , second selling rm6700

-service will slight more expensive than your current - more expensive tyre , chain , use better 2t oil~~

-top speed tried 180kmh for standard -GPS is 150 +-

-full trottle from kl-sban no problem *friend tried kl-penang full trottle.. just stop for petrol

-is a fast bike , cheaper maintenance than any 250r , pickup can win 250r =)

-2t is super save. 1000km for 1 L - 3 times lesser than ur current RGV 2t consumption

just buy it, but remember,
1. hot bike
2. usage maintenance is still affordable, fuel is consider ok compared to its power, dont compare to kapcai..
3. 4t no need worry much, 2t oil lasts about 1000km, (cost wise consider same as using 4t bike la, they still need to change oil monthly what)
4. top speed is enough at kampung and city road. (proven can go 200kmh on its meter with pillion, maybe gps is 170kmh only)
5. parts are not cheap, especially engine part.. so, better u buy 1st hand, as u dont know what the 1st owner did to the bike.. maybe got jammed once, u dunno lol...
6. fyi, the original CDI is RM1.4k... so, if kena sebat, rugi gila..

no, 10000km or ten thousand km,
should do at least top overhaul..

two strokes nature, the performance will degrade faster than four strokes bike..
the exhaust also need to be clean, because of "tahi minyak 2t"..


Added on November 30, 2012, 5:55 pmkips got powervalve,
so it is important, every 10000km, the powervalve also need to be polished back..


sebabnya, carbon build up..


btw, u can use it without servicing until 100000000km also can,
but, dont complain if powervalve jam, engine run very slow...
